Why is it important to evaluate and critique art ?

Art criticism is the discussion or evaluation of visual art.[1][2][3] Art critics usually criticise art in the context of aesthetics or the theory of beauty.

Art criticism and appreciation can be subjective based on personal preference toward aesthetics and form, or it can be based on the elements and principle of design and by social and cultural acceptance.
Artists have often had an uneasy relationship with their critics.

Artists usually need positive opinions from critics for their work to be viewed and purchased

The fact that Chinese speakers may be more likely to think about time on a vertical or a horizontal plane is an example of what
kirill [66]

Answer: Linguistic Determinism

Explanation:

Edward Sapir and later Benjamin Lee Worf espoused that the language a human speaks can have an effect on the way their mind processes mental functions such as memory, thought and perception.

This called the <em>Sapir–Whorf hypothesis</em> and Linguistic Determinism is the form of it that explains why Chinese speakers may be more likely to think about time on a vertical or a horizontal plane.

What do the dots above the repeated notes in measure 2 mean?
aliya0001 [1]

Answer:

The dots are called Staccato, it is to perform each note sharply detached or separated from others.
